soundwire: extend SDW_SLAVE_ENTRY

The SoundWire 1.2 specification adds new capabilities that were not
present in previous version, such as the class ID.

To enable support for class drivers, and well as drivers that address
a specific version, all fields of the sdw_device_id structure need to
be exposed. For SoundWire 1.0 and 1.1 devices, a wildcard is used so
class and version information are ignored.
